Lupin launches insulin glargine in India:

Indian pharma company, Lupin Limited announced a strategic distribution agreement with LG Life Sciences of South Korea to launch Insulin Glargine, a novel insulin analogue under the brand name Basugine™.

According to the agreement, Lupin would be responsible for marketing and sales of Basugine™ in India.

Love, cast in stone: Temples in India depicting erotic art

India is dotted with many glorious temples, but erotica on the walls of some arouses curiosity and even puzzles tourists. There are various theories about the reason for such vivid depiction of erotica–mass sex education, warding off natural calamities and the devdasi system. Due to the presence of 64 Yogini temples near Khajuraho, Padawali, Konarak/Lingaraj etc., scholars also attribute the erotic art to Tantric practices, which revolve around the ultimate union of the male and the female energy and forms referred to as Maithuna. Whatever the reason be, the brazenness or ethereal beauty of temple erotica will never cease to amaze us.

Khajuraho, Madhya Pradesh

Built by the Chandela Kings who were greatly influenced by Tantric traditions, this temple is said to represent the ultimate seductress.

While the fine sandstone statues built earlier have a well rounded finish, the ones made later are more angular. In his history of the Kamasutra, Mc Connachie describes the amorous sculptures as “the apogee of erotic art”, where the twisting, broad hipped and high breasted nymphs, fleshy apsaras and extravagantly interlocked maithunas run riot along the surface of stone.

The various scenes of passionate love making, in acrobatic postures that sometimes border on the physically impossible, strike viewers. Look out for the bold panels of multiple partners engaged with each other. For an interesting perspective on Khajuraho, watch the Sound and Light show. The best time to visit is during the Khajuraho Dance Festival in the first week of February.

Markandeshwar Temple, Maharashtra

Near the naxal district of Gadchiroli, the Markandeshwar temple complex, by the River Wainganga, showcases a sprinkling of erotic art. A couple performing ‘fellacio’ will raise eyebrows. Know to be built by danavas (evil forces) in one night, the temple is made from stone, and follows Hemadpanth architecture. The annual fair during Mahashivratri attracts devotees from far and wide every year. Hiring a car from Nagpur is recommended, unless you fancy hitch-hiking with villagers past moonlit fields or changing several buses and autos. If you’re stranded, look for the dharamshala near the temple.

Padawali Temple,  Madhya Pradesh

In Morena district near the Chambal Valley, once notorious for dacoits, lies the fortress of Padawali. Two stalwart lion statues greet you at its entrance. The temple inside has earned the reputation being a ‘Mini Khajuraho’ due to the prevalence of erotic art. The difference between big brother Khajuraho and Padawali Temple, is that the erotic art here seems less acrobatic and more ‘real life’ and ‘doable’. The carvings of maithunas in various positions, ranging from simple to difficult almost brings the Kamasutra to life.

Ranakpur Jain Temples, Rajasthan

This marble temple of superlative beauty is a ‘vision in white’ with its domes, shikharas and turrets. Over 1,444 intricately carved marble pillars hold up the temple and a monolithic marble rock depicting over 100 snakes catches the eye. Look out for a panel depicting several experimental love making scenes, in a line with a central queen-like figure seated on a throne, with an amorous midget on her lap. It’s interesting to note that not only Hindus, but even Jains decorated temples with erotic art. It hints at how nudity had a religious connect due to the ‘Digambara’ ideology or the Tantric cult.

Sun Temple,  Orissa 

When I first visited the Sun Temple at Konarak in Orissa, as a giggly 16-year-old , I was  taken aback by how the panels revealed way more about the ‘birds and bees’ than our biology classes had taught us. My second visit recently, helped me appreciate the beautiful erotic art better. The brazenness of the sculptures here gives Khajuraho stiff competition; one of the most scandalous panels is of a dog licking a woman’s genital area. I overheard a guide say, “this was considered a cure for sex related infections, as the dog’s saliva has antibiotic properties.” Scenes of polygamy, polyandry and lesbian love are blissfully abundant.

An architectural genius, this temple shows the Sun God on a colossal chariot drawn by seven horses. The word Konarak is a combination of Kona (corner) and Arka (Sun).  The temple was previously located closer to the sea, but the magnetic properties of its stone caused shipwrecks. This, along with the dark colour of its stones, earned it the tile of ‘The Black Pagoda’. An interesting study in contrast is the famous Jagannath Temple at Puri, also referred to as ‘The White Pagoda’ due to its whitewashed walls. If you are an art enthusiast you must visit the Konarak Archaeological Museum nearby that contains fallen sculptures from the temple.

Sun Temple, Gujarat

It is believed to be the place where Lord Rama conducted a yagna here to purify himself of the sin of killing a Brahmana-Ravana. Like Konarak, its architecture is such that the temple catches the first rays of the rising sun. The most striking feature of the temple is a perfectly designed Kama Kunda (water tank) meant for ablutions and for a reflection of the temple in the water. It has lateral stone steps leading down to the tank, allowing both direct and diagonal descent from all sides. Carvings of men and women in various acts of sex with small midget like creatures are prominent. However, due to erosion the detailing of the stone carvings is blurred in places.

Osian, Rajasthan

Amidst the sand dunes of Thar, Osian has a cluster of Hindu and Jain temples dating back to the 11 century AD. The Sachiya Mata temple dedicated to the resident Goddess has a gorgeous carved archway leading up to the shrine and has some beautiful depiction of erotic love locked couples, complete with details like the bed on which the couples lie.

Virupaksha Temple, Karnataka
On the banks of the Tungabhadra River, this temple with beautiful pillars and towered gateways dedicated to Lord Shiva in his avatar as Virupaksha. It is one of the oldest functioning temples since the 7th century AD. A  panel  that catches the eyes depicts a nude woman being ‘admired’ by men and women around her. It is best to visit the temple, during the Hampi festival in November. While in the area, also check out the erotic art on the pillars of the Achyutaraya temple.

Several other temples in South India like Belur, Halebidu, Somanathapura and Nugguhalli, the Badami and Banashankari temples of the Chalukya times and the Vijayanagar temples of Bhatkal and Lepakshi also have a profusion of erotic art. The Meenakshi temple of Madurai and Veeraranarayan temple of Gadag have erotic sculptures on their Gopuram. (Information about other temples with erotic art in South India taken from www.kamat.com)

No one has summed up the beauty of erotica on temple walls better than Tagore while he was referring to Konarak, ‘The language of man here is defeated by the language of stone.’

IUPAC Name: [(2S,4R,5R,5aS,6S,8S,9aR,10aS)-5,6-diacetyloxy-2,8-dihydroxy-10a-(2-hydroxypropan-2-yl)-3,5a-dimethyl-9-methylidene-2,4,5,6,7,8,9a,10-octahydro-1H-benzo[g]azulen-4-yl] benzoate | CAS Registry Number: 134955-83-2

Synonyms: Brevifoliol, CHEBI:555808, CID178222, 134955-83-2

Brevifoliol was first isolated from the leaves of the plant Taxus brevifolia (F. Balza et al Phytochemistry 30, p. 1613-1614 (1991)). The process of its isolation involved extracting the fresh leaves of Taxus wallichiana with ethyl alcohol to get an extract. The crude extract after concentration was diluted with water and partitioned between hexane, chloroform and ethyl acetate sequentially. The chloroform extract upon concentration yielded a dark brown residue. The resultant residue was subjected to column chromatography over silica gel and eluted with chloroform and chloroform-methanol gradient. Six fractions were collected and brevifoliol was isolated from fraction five by rechromatography over silica gel and eluting with hexane-ethyl acetate gradient.

 

Brevifoliol has been isolated from other species of Taxus including the Himalayan yew Taxus wallichiana which is available in India., Recently, the structure of brevifoliol has been revised and it was shown to belong to 11 (15→1) abeo taxoid bicyclic skeleton of formula (1). The isolation of brevifoliol from leaves of the plantTaxus wallichiana is also reported in S. K. Chattopadhyay et al Indian J. Chemistry 35B, 175-177(1996) as part of studies on the isolation of anticancer compounds. The process of this disclosure involved extracting the dried and crushed needles of Taxus wallichiana with methanol for 72 hours and the extract was concentrated in vacuo. The concentrate was diluted with water and extracted with hexane and chloroform respectively. Concentration of the chloroform phase under vacuum left a residue which was separated by column chromatography over silica gel. Fraction eluted with chloroform-methanol (98:5) contained brevifoliol which was further purified by re-chromatography over silica gel and eluted with chloroform-methanol (99:2). Fractions containing brevifoliol were combined and concentrated and recrystallized from pet-ether and ethyl acetate mixture to get brevifoliol as needles. In in vitro testing of brevifoliol, it was found to have significant anticancer activity against different cancer cell lines. The detection of anticancer activity in brevifoliol prompted the present investigators to develop an efficient processing technology for isolation of the compound in large quantities from the needles of the plant for further biological testing.

The prior art process of isolation of brevifoliol suffers from a number of disadvantages including partitioning of the aqueous extract with hexane and chloroform and repeated column chromatography to get the compound. Although the partitioning of the aqueous phase with organic solvents works on small scale, it forms thick emulsions on large scale partitioning process and creates hindrance in getting the fractions separated. Also, the use of repeated chromatography might be useful on small-scale isolation of brevifoliol, it is only cumbersome, tedious and not economical on large-scale process.

Assignee: Council of Scientific and Industrial Research, New Delhi, India

Title or Subject: Process for Preparing Brevifoliol
Brevifoliol  is found in the leaves of the plants of the genus Taxus and is useful as an anticancer agent. This patent describes a method of extracting from the leaves of the plantTaxus wallichiana (Tw) Alternative methods are known for extracting from Tw but they are said to suffer from several disadvantages. These include partitioning of an aqueous extract with hexane and CHCl3 and the repeated use of chromatography to obtain the purified compound. The partitioning is said to work well on a small scale, but on a large scale thick emulsions are formed. Hence, the objective of the work in this patent is to provide a process that can be operated on a large scale. The process developed comprises the following steps:
  • (i) Dry and pulverize the leaves of the plant.
  • (ii) Extract the dried leaves with an alcohol such as MeOH or EtOH at 20−40 °C over 3 days.
  • (iii) Concentrate the alcoholic solution and adsorb the extract onto Celite.
  • (iv) Dry the Celite adsorbate at 20−50 °C for up to 48 h.
  • (v) Extract the dried adsorbate with 60−80 petroleum ether then CHCl3 and concentrate the CHCl3 extract.
  • (vi) Subject the concentrated mixture to gross fractionation over a column of silica gel using CHCl3 add 2% MeOH in CHCl3.
  • (vii) Subject the later eluate to further chromatography over alumina in petroleum ether using 10% EtOAc in petroleum ether.
  • (viii) Recrystallise  from EtOAc/petroleum ether as needles.
Brevifoliol

Advantages


The patent claims that the solvents can be recycled so that the process is cost-effective. Certainly it is true that avoiding water removes the emulsification problem, but two chromatographic steps are involved, and the use of so many solvents would seem to create handling problems on a commercial plant.

India revokes more pharma patents

2 August 2013Phillip Broadwith

India’s Intellectual Property Appellate Board has revoked one of two patents granted to GlaxoSmithKline for its cancer drug lapatinib. The board decided that, while developing lapatinib itself represents a viable invention, developing the ditosylate salt form (marketed as Tykerb) is an obvious development and therefore not patentable.

The two patents on the tyrosine kinase inhibitor were challenged by German generics company Fresenius Kabi Oncology. The decisions follow a string of similar rulings in which Indian authorities have revoked or refused to grant drug patents, in an effort to drive generic competition.
